Winter Temperature in Cairo and Delta
Cairo‘s daytime highs are around 18°C (66°F), while the nightly lows are around 10°C (50°F). The Nile-Delta region of Cairo and the surrounding area will require you to pack a light jacket as well as potentially a hat and scarf for the evenings and early mornings. As a result, confirm that your hotel has heat at night, as many don’t, especially around the coasts.
Winter Temperature in South Egypt and the Red Sea
In Winter, Luxor, and Aswan in The South temperature goes from (68°F) to 25°C (78°F). While Hurghada and Sharm El Sheikh on the Red Sea temperature go from 18°C (65°F) to 23°C (75°F). A rain jacket or wet weather clothing isn’t necessary for Cairo or the southern areas of the country because there is little rain. For example, Alexandria has an average of 11 days of precipitation per year, so if you’re planning a trip to the northern coast, be sure you’re well prepared.
Is it safe to visit the pyramids in Cairo?
You might encounter many people at the pyramids who would try to sell you a camel or horse rides, souvenir, or tour guide. It slightly gets annoying, but there is nothing dangerous about it. Tourists at well-known landmarks such as the Giza Pyramids are often given attention from merchants more than Egyptians. The conclusion is to always try to stay with a tour guide or as a part of group extrusions. Professional tour guides are always a great add to your trip.

How much does it cost to enter the pyramids?
A day in Egypt prices around £200, not including the amazing pyramids and sphinx.The interiors of Khufu’s pyramid cost 400 pounds to tour; however, the interiors of the intermediate and minor pyramids only cost £100. You may also visit the Queen’s Pyramids and the Solar Boat Museum, which both require a separate ticket.

How should a woman dress in Egypt?
Egyptians are thought to dress modestly by most in the West. Women in Egypt, both residents and visitors, are not forced to adhere to any clothing codes. Because it is only a social construct wearing clothes that cover your cleavage, knees, and shoulders, skirts, blouses, jeans, any form of pants, and anything else that fulfills these qualities are suitable in Egyptian culture. Crop tops and shorts are unusual on city streets and in religious groups. As a consequence, establishing a balance between your personal style and cultural norms is typically a win-win situation for everyone.
Is Egypt safe for solo female tourists?
Female visitors may feel a bit uneasy in a number of Egyptian towns. Although serious crime and violence are uncommon in Egypt, public catcalling is common, and women travelling alone are frequently harassed. If at all possible, travel in groups of three or more people and remain on well-lit streets.
Even if the situation is safer than it was previously and in contrast to other Middle Eastern countries, it may be inconvenient in some locations. It is appropriate for a touristy and congested region.

Can you hold hands in Egypt?
Holding handscould be acceptable, but try to keep the following notes on Egyptian culture in mind. Kissing on the street can result in penalties or incarceration in Egypt due to public display of affection regulations, which implies that kissing or hugging on the road can result in a fine or jail, particularly for Egyptians. Many Egyptians citizens, on the other hand, object to embracing, kissing, and other public affection because of societal moral values that must be observed when visiting the nation.
